RBB Fund Market Risk Analysis

Today, many novice investors tend to focus exclusively on investment returns with little concern for RBB Fund's investment risk. Standard deviation is the most common way to measure market volatility of etfs, such as The RBB Fund, and traders can use it to determine the average amount a RBB Fund's price has deviated from the expected return over a period of time. It is calculated by determining the expected price for the established period and then subtracting this figure from each price point. The differences are then squared, summed, and averaged to produce the variance.
